#493459 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#493459 is composed of 28.6% red, 20.4%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18% cyan, 41.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 274.1 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 27.6%. #493459 color hex could be obtained by blending #9268b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#493459 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#493459 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#493459 has RGB values of R:73, G:52,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4797529.

Shades and Tints of #493459
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f7f5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#493459
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474449 is the less saturated color, while #50038a is the most saturated one.
